Weather Considerations
When planning a business paint task, weather condition considerations are essential. You need to keep an eye on temperature level and moisture degrees, as they can dramatically affect paint application and drying out times.
Preferably, you wish to schedule your task during light climate-- temperatures between 50 ° F and 85 ° F are normally best for most paints. Severe warm can create the paint to completely dry also promptly, causing fractures, while low temperatures can decrease drying out, permitting dirt and debris to choose the damp surface.
Rainfall is one more factor to think about. Paint outside throughout wet problems can bring about bad attachment and a greater chance of peeling later on. view it now to inspect the forecast and plan your project for a stretch of dry days.
Wind can additionally be a worry, specifically if you're collaborating with spray paint, as it can trigger overspray and irregular insurance coverage.
Finally, seasonal modifications can modify your timeline. Springtime and autumn commonly give one of the most beneficial problems, so take into consideration these seasons when arranging your industrial paint job.

Seasonal Trends and Demand
Comprehending seasonal trends and demand is important for preparing your business painting project successfully. Different periods bring differing weather, which can significantly influence the timing of your project.
Springtime and early summer usually present the most effective opportunities for external paint, as the temperature levels are mild and completely dry. This is when need generally peaks, so scheduling early can guarantee you protect the ideal contractor at an affordable rate.
Loss can also be a blast for outside work, as lots of organizations aim to rejuvenate their spaces prior to winter. However, as temperatures drop, you may deal with delays because of weather constraints.
On the other hand, winter months is typically an off-peak season, making it an economical time for indoor paint. With less projects on the table, contractors are commonly a lot more versatile and can prioritize your requirements.
Bear in mind that holidays and neighborhood events can affect schedule, so strategy ahead.
